SEATTLE, March 11, 2015 /PRNewswire/ --

Magicflix, the curated video streaming service for kids that offers families a safe alternative to the uncertainties of internet-available video has raised over $500,000. The round includes notable investments from Geoff Entress andAndrew Wright.

Launched in November 2014, in just a few months Magicflix, a Techstars Seattle startup, has already gained a loyal following among tech-savvy parents.

Their library of popular, kid-friendly videos is available by subscription only, so there are no ads, and no risk of kids accidentally clicking away to inappropriate content. It also features educational content from around the world.

With a $4.99 monthly subscription fee, MagicFlix is poaching families away from sites like Netflix and YouTube for three reasons: Its closed environment allows kids to watch their favorite videos without the risks of being on the internet; It offers parents the ability to create their own playlists of YouTube content; and it offers a completely ad-free environment. So busy parents can hand their kids a tablet or a smartphone, tap open Magicflix, and feel confident about what their kids will and will not be exposed to.

Magicflix_edited.jpg

"Nobody wants their kids to watch videos all day, but for the times that kids are consuming video content, we want to make it a safe, fun and fantastic experience for everyone. That's why we went with a subscription model. As parents, we know that a couple of bucks a month is a small price to pay for peace of mind," said Magicflix CEO, Mamtha Banerjee. "This latest round will allow us to continue developing our apps and invest in acquiring more great content."

In addition to commercial content, Magicflix helps kids discover hidden gems by licensing videos from partners around the world. Notable names include The Digits, Okee Dokee Brothers, Recess Monkey, Gustafer Yellowgold, and many more.
